Inspecting for Worn or Broken Parts
1. Springs and Cables
Springs and cables are responsible for lifting and lowering the garage door. Worn or broken springs can cause the door to become unbalanced, making it difficult to open or close. Cables can also fray or snap, which can prevent the door from moving at all.
To inspect the springs and cables, visually examine them for any signs of damage, such as rust, cracks, or fraying. You can also try opening and closing the door manually to see if there is any resistance or binding.
2. Rollers and Tracks
Rollers and tracks guide the garage door as it moves up and down. Worn or damaged rollers can cause the door to become noisy, while damaged tracks can prevent the door from moving smoothly.
To inspect the rollers and tracks, look for any signs of wear or damage, such as flat spots, cracks, or missing parts. You can also try rolling the door up and down by hand to see if there is any resistance or binding.
3. Hinges and Screws
Hinges and screws connect the different parts of the garage door together. Worn or loose hinges can cause the door to become misaligned or unstable, while loose screws can allow the door to come apart.
To inspect the hinges and screws, visually examine them for any signs of wear or damage, such as rust, cracks, or missing parts. You can also try tightening the screws to see if they are loose.

Troubleshooting Chain-Drive vs. Belt-Drive Openers
Chain-drive and belt-drive garage door openers are the two primary types of openers on the market. They both have their own unique advantages and disadvantages. If you’re not sure which type of opener is right for you, consult with a professional garage door technician.
Chain-Drive Openers
Chain-drive openers are the most common type of opener. They are relatively inexpensive, easy to install, and require little maintenance. However, they can be noisy and the chain may stretch or break over time, requiring replacement.

Comparison of Chain-Drive and Belt-Drive Openers
The following table compares the two types of openers:
| Feature | Chain-Drive | Belt-Drive |
|---|---|---|
| Cost | Less expensive | More expensive |
| Installation | Easier to install | More difficult to install |
| Noise | Noisy | Quiet |
| Maintenance | Requires more maintenance | Requires less maintenance |
| Durability | Less durable | More durable |
Choosing the Right Opener Type
The best type of garage door opener for you will depend on your individual needs and preferences. If you’re looking for a budget-friendly option, a chain-drive opener is a good choice. If you want a quieter, low-maintenance opener, a belt-drive opener is a better option.
